This weekend, Southwest University Park will host two sold-out Banana Ball games featuring the Texas Tailgaters and the Firefighters, promising a unique entertainment experience that could significantly benefit El Paso's economy. Scheduled for May 15-16, the events are expected to draw large crowds, including many visitors from Mexico, as tickets sold out rapidly. Attendees can enjoy a street party starting at 3:30 p.m. before the gates open at 5:30 p.m., with the games kicking off at 6:30 p.m. The Savannah Bananas, known for their lively performances, will add excitement with choreographed dances and unexpected celebrations during the game.
